    Great to hear about your experience. Those discus look very nice. I expect they'll look even nicer in two weeks when they're fully settled in.

    Starting off with healthy, quality stock is a critical success factor. I can't emphasize enough the importance of getting your discus from SD sponsors, particularly if you're just getting started in the hobby. We've already seen two reports of disasters in the New Year when people buy from off brand importers. After three decades in the hobby, I know a number of sponsors and regard them as friends. However, there are also some practical reasons why they are also your best options.

    1. Simply buyers run the gamut from beginners to advanced hobbyists, including those who are very picky on quality. Unlike some importers on the Internet, SD sponsors must compete on quality. They have to post pictures/videos of their fish repeatedly and every fish they post is judged for color, size, shape, deportment, etc. by very experienced hobbyists. If they steal pictures from other importers, someone here usually calls it out.

    2. SD sponsors have to be very careful about shipping the absolute healthiest fish. If anything goes wrong, the entire forum will know. Our sponsors rely on their reputation for repeat business. Over time, a bad shipment will slip through. In my experience though, the sponsor always goes overboard to satisfy the hobbyist to protect his/her reputation.

    3. Simply buyers are not local, so SD sponsors are experienced in packing and shipping - especially in cold weather conditions. I've had discus delivered to my fishroom when the temperature dips below zero outside and the water is warm to the touch. I also provide feedback to the sellers on how their packaging fared under these conditions.

    When new hobbyists ask about discus suppliers, they always get referred to our sponsors. I think they believe we do this for financial reasons. Actually, we do this for discus reasons.
